Biblipedia
Biblipedia
A social web tool, allowing users to annotate books, create literature reviews, share notes, and find readings and notes by other users. A social scholarly bibliographical annotation tool. Funded by CEMP, Bournemouth University's Media School Centre of Excellence in Learning and Teaching Media Practice.
